About this application

Acutis Firewall is an Android content-filtering application intended for parental control. It blocks access to adult material and to sites its filtering rules classify as dangerous. Filtering is described as taking place on the device itself, meaning traffic is evaluated locally rather than being routed through an external filtering service.

The listing does not state how the filtering rules are obtained or updated, whether categories can be adjusted, or how the configuration is protected from changes by the device's user — all of which matter for a parental-control tool and should be checked against the current release. As an on-device filter it also acts only on the device where it is installed, and not on other equipment sharing the same network.

The application is published by phasnox under the MIT licence. It is available for Android only.
